WebFeb 23, 2024 · Sample size estimation for paired student t tests. In biostatistics, when comparing paired measurements (such as changes between two time points for the same subject) using a paired Student t test, the effect size is expressed as the ratio of Δ (delta, the mean change) divided by σ (sigma, the standard deviation of the changes).
